Who is Yehuda Kahane?

Yehuda Kahane is the 2011 recipient of the highly prestigious award in the insurance and risk management for his pioneering and lasting contribution to both the theory, practice and education in insurance..

Kahane is active in both the academic and business areas.

He is a professor of insurance and finance, Faculty of Management, and Head of the Akirov Institute f

or Business and the Environment, Tel-Aviv University. He founded and served as the Dean of the first academic school of insurance in Israel. At Tel Aviv University he directed the Erhard Insurance Center, the Actuarial studies program, and coordinated the Executives Development Programs. He is a life and non-life actuary.

Since 1966, Kahane has taught at universities around the Globe, including, among others, the Wharton School of the University of Pennsylvania, the University of Texas at Austin, the Hebrew University of Jerusalem, the University of Florida, and the University of Toronto. He has founded, and directed the Israel CLU Program. He organized and lectured in hundreds of seminars and conferences.
